You Too Can Join a Motorcycle Gang

Want to join a motorcycle gang, but not sure where to look? Afraid that all gangs are violent and exclusive? Looking for a way to leverage your unique qualities into a patch of honor?

Then you've come to the right place. The editors at SpotMotorcycles.com have found a motorcycle gang (or club) to suit each and every one of their readers.

Here's the link:
Unique Motorcycle Clubs and Gangs

And here's an excerpt:

First up for your consideration is The YCC — The Yamaha Custom Club of Benelux -- a motorcycle club for grandmothers only. Yup, you heard that right -- nannas only.Started in the Netherlands, fifteen grandmas took to riding together and decided to go for a Guinness World Record of the most grandmothers on motorcycles at a single gathering. Once assembled, they looked around, decided that grandmas on bikes were cool, fun and bad-ass. You've got to admit, if YOUR grandma was a biker wouldn't you brag?

So a one-time attempt to win a record turned into an established club. The club is expanding throughout France, Italy, the Czech Republic and North America. The only requirement is that you are somebody's Granny. All you Grandpa's move along to the next option.

The Last Buell - XB12Scg

The Last Buell Motorcycle

Sadly, the last Buell motorcycle, an XB12Scg, rolled off the East Troy Wisconsin assembly line on October 30th.

Buell built 136,923 motorcycles in 26 years of operation. Buell motorcycles will continue to be sold through existing dealers until inventory is depleted.
